Texans DL Jadeveon Clowney came into the 2014 NFL Draft out of South Carolina touted as a sure fire guaranteed superstar.  But after injury-riddled 2014 and 2015 seasons, people were quick to label him a bust.  Well, Clowney may not be out of the woods yet, but he has quieted his critics in 2016, as he having a stellar season and, according to Pro Football Talk, is “emerging as one of the best defensive players in the league.”  Here’s an interception by Clowney in the 1st quarter of today’s wild card playoff game against the Raiders…
